After a week of accusations being thrown around that always-online wasn't actually necessary to keep SimCity running, and that it was tacked on merely as DRM, EA's finally trying to make amends by offering up a free game to SimCity buyers.
The eight games up for the offer are the following:
· Battlefield 3 (Standard Edition)
· Bejeweled 3
· Dead Space 3 (Standard Edition)
· Mass Effect 3 (Standard Edition)
· Medal of Honor: Warfighter (Standard Edition)
· Need For Speed Most Wanted (Standard Edition)
· Plants vs. Zombies
· SimCity 4 Deluxe Edition

The offer is even valid for new SimCity buyers until March 25th. However, the game must be redeemed by March 30th, or else the offer will no longer be available. Two games for the price of one? Sounds like a deal…
